223101231200227 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 223101231200228. Its totient is φ = 223101231200226.

The previous prime is 223101231200209. The next prime is 223101231200387. The reversal of 223101231200227 is 722002132101322.

It is a happy number.

It is a weak prime.

It is a cyclic number.

It is not a de Polignac number, because 223101231200227 - 247 = 82363742844899 is a prime.

It is a super-3 number, since 3×2231012312002273 (a number of 44 digits) contains 333 as substring.

It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 223101231200195 and 223101231200204.

It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(223101238200227) by changing a digit.

It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 111550615600113 + 111550615600114.

It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(111550615600114).

Almost surely, 2223101231200227 is an apocalyptic number.

223101231200227 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).

223101231200227 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.

223101231200227 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.

The product of its (nonzero) digits is 4032, while the sum is 28.

Adding to 223101231200227 its reverse (722002132101322), we get a palindrome (945103363301549).
